Paris and Helen, after pl.24, vol.4 of "Antiquités étrusques, grecques, et romaines tirées du cabinet de M. Hamilton"

18th century
Not on view
This print is a later version of one published as pl.24, vol.4 of Antiquités étrusques, grecques, et romaines tirées du cabinet de M. Hamilton, by Pierre d’Hancarville, in Naples in 1766.
